Solon's Drainage Challenges

SOM Center Road Neighborhoods

The Problem: Established neighborhoods near SOM Center Road have decades of settling that changed original grading. Yards that once sloped away from foundations now slope toward them. Mature trees have shifted soil and created new water pathways that didn't exist when the homes were built.

Our Solution: Regrading to restore proper slope away from foundations, combined with French drains along the foundation perimeter and underground downspout extensions. We work carefully around mature landscaping to preserve the character of these established properties.

Harper Road Developments

The Problem: Newer developments off Harper Road have close-set homes that create runoff concentration between properties. Each home's downspouts, driveway runoff, and grading direct water into the narrow spaces between houses — creating chronic moisture problems for both neighbors.

Our Solution: Curtain drains between properties, underground downspout extensions with pop-up emitters, and channel drains along property boundaries. We design systems that solve your drainage without pushing the problem onto your neighbor.
